Regioselective Tele‐Substitution of Aroyl Chlorides via Activation by an Al/P Frustrated Lewis Pair
A tele‐substitution of aroyl chlorides with silyl ketene acetals is enabled by an ortho‐phenylene‐linked Al/P frustrated Lewis pair. Intramolecular aluminum activation polarizes the aroylphosphonium intermediate, promoting regioselective dearomative nucleophilic addition to the aromatic ring.

Arylhydrazonomalononitriles 1a,b react with phenylhydrazine to yield amidrazones 2a,b that cyclize to give 2-aryl-5-phenylhydrazono-2,5-dihydro-[1,2,4]-triazine-6-carbonitriles 5a,b upon reaction with dimethylformamide dimethylacetal (DMFDMA).

Synthesis of Some New 1,2,4-Triazine and 1,2,5-Oxadiazine Derivatives with Antimicrobial Activity
1,2,4-Triazine and 1,2,5-oxadiazine derivatives 2–12 were obtained from treated 1,3-oxazolone (1) with phenyl hydrazine or hydroxylamine hydrochloride.
